Fortunately, the Commonwealth of Virginia adopted what is basically a formulation for baby support calculation.

We will contemplate homelessness when reviewing a fee waiver request. If you receive services from a homeless shelter, please include a at present dated letter from the shelter. The letter must be on the shelter’s letterhead, embody an announcement that you receive services from the shelter, and be signed by a shelter employee testing to your situation. If you’re homeless but don’t reside in a shelter, please embrace an affidavit from a member of excellent standing in your neighborhood who knows you and might support your claim that you’re homeless and unable to pay the fee.

If you examine the field that states the child has been emancipated by a courtroom order, you should attach a certified copy of the courtroom order declaring the child emancipated. You can get a licensed copy of the order of emancipation from the clerk of the court docket where the emancipation order was entered. The price for an authorized copy of a courtroom record is usually below $5.00, depending on the number of pages.
